2019 NAIA Football Game of the Week No. 9

KANSAS CITY, Mo. – The National Association of Intercollegiate Athletics (NAIA) announced that the NAIA Football Game of the Week for November 9 will be No. 2 Marian (Ind.) at No. 25 Marian (Ind.). The game was selected by fans across the country in an online vote.

The first historical meeting between the two teams on senior day figures to be a thrilling one as the two Mid States Football Association Mideast Division teams will meet on the home field of underdog Indiana Wesleyan in Marion, Ind.

It is just year No. 2 for Indiana Wesleyan football, and the program is already turning heads in perhaps the most daunting division in NAIA Football. 2019 represents the first season the Wildcats are playing in the Mid States Mideast, which features five, NAIA Top 25 teams including themselves and Marian. Saint Francis (Ind.), Siena Heights (Mich.) and Concordia (Mich.) are the other three representatives.

The Wildcats rank No. 2 as a team in fourth down conversion percentage, converting at 75 percent (9-for-12 in 2019). As a whole, Indiana Wesleyan is balanced in all three phases of the game. Kicker Ben VonGunten is statistically one of the top kickers and punters in NAIA Football, while wide receiver Brayden Smith is ranked ninth in the country with 6.5 receptions per game. This season, VonGuten is ranked No. 4 in the nation in punt yards per game (42.9).

On the defensive side of the ball, Indiana Wesleyan has also seen its share of success. Linebackers Adam Schantz and Justin Brown are both tied at No. 13 in the nation in forced fumbles per game (0.300). The duo, however, is also tied at that position with Marian linebacker Nickai Poyser.

Marian will enter Saturday’s contest undefeated and a win would secure a regular season crown in the MSFA Mideast. In order to run the table, however, the Knights will need to defeat two, Top 25 conference opponents in Indiana Wesleyan and No. 21 Siena Heights (Mich.) next week to close-out their regular season slate.

The Knights feature arguably the top defense in the nation in 2019. Marian is holding opponents to just over 125 yards in the air per game, which is the top pass defense in the nation. Overall, the team is also ranked No. 1 in overall defense per game, holding its opponents to a remarkable 197 yards of offense per game.

Marian has had just two games this season that its opponent has held it to less than 40 points. Overall, the Knights are averaging 42.29 points per game.

Running back Charles Salary needs just 19 yards on Saturday to reach 1,000 yards on the ground for the season.
